Entry requirements

Entry requirements set by ASQA are the basic qualifications and criteria that students must meet before enrolling in a nationally recognised course.

These requirements ensure students have the skills and knowledge needed to undertake this course.

  • There are no formal academic requirements
  • Additional entry requirements are set by individual course providers

Graduates of the Certificate II in Introduction to Aged Care are well-prepared to pursue various career opportunities, including roles such as Home Care Assistance Workers, Support Workers, and Community Support Workers. These positions are crucial for delivering personal care and support services that enhance the quality of life for elderly individuals.
